Frozen Pipe Water Removal vs. DIY: When to Call a Professional

Situation DIY? Call a Pro? Why
Minor water damage from a frozen pipe Yes Maybe You can DIY minor cleanups, but call a pro if the damage is extensive or you’re unsure of the cause.
Severe water damage from a burst pipe No Yes Call a pro for severe water damage to prevent further damage and ensure a thorough cleanup.
Hidden water damage from a frozen pipe No Yes Hidden water damage can lead to costly repairs if not addressed quickly. Call a pro for a thorough inspection and cleanup.
Water damage from a frozen pipe in a crawl space No Yes Crawl spaces can be difficult to access and need specialized equipment to clean and dry. Call a pro for safe and efficient service.
Water damage from a frozen pipe in a commercial building No Yes Commercial buildings need specialized equipment and expertise to clean and dry affected areas. Call a pro for safe and efficient service.
Water damage from a frozen pipe with hazardous materials present No Yes Water damage in areas with hazardous materials, such as asbestos or lead, needs specialized equipment and expertise to clean and dry safely. Call a pro for safe and efficient service.

How do I prevent Frozen Pipe Water Removal from happening in the first place?

To prevent Frozen Pipe Water Removal, consider insulating exposed pipes draining outdoor hoses and keeping your home warm during extremely cold weather. Regular maintenance and inspections can also help identify potential issues before they become major problems.
